    This combination chain whip and freewheel / lockring remover wrench is heat treated to prevent bending and flexing, with a molded handle for comfort.
    • Works on 5- to 12-speed cassettes and freewheels
    • 1" (25.4mm) box-end wrench fits Park Tool Freewheel/Cassette Lockring Tools
    • Features hardened pins to keep the chain in place

    Park Tool has been manufacturing bicycle specific tools since 1963. Based out of St. Paul Minnesota, we are the world's largest bicycle tool manufacturer. A long-term dedication to quality, innovation, and customer service has made Park Tool the first choice of professional and home bicycle mechanics around the world.
